--- /dev/null	Thu Jan 01 00:00:00 1970 +0000
+++ b/CbC-examples/fact-a.c	Tue Sep 20 17:32:20 2011 +0900
@@ -0,0 +1,36 @@
+#define __environment _CbC_environment
+#define __return _CbC_return
+
+#include "stdio.h"
+
+__code factorial(int n,int result,int orig,__code(*print)(),__code(*exit1)(), void *exit1env)
+{
+    if (n<0) {
+	printf("#0008:err %d!\n",n);
+	goto (*exit1)(0,exit1env);
+    }
+    if (n==0)
+	goto (*print)(n,result,orig,print,exit1,exit1env);
+    else {
+	result *= n;
+	n--;
+	goto factorial(n,result,orig,print,exit1,exit1env);
+    }
+}
+
+__code print(int n,int result,int orig,__code(*print)(),__code (*exit1)(),void*exit1env);
+
+int main( int ac, char *av[])
+{
+    int n;
+    // n = atoi(av[1]);
+    n = 10;
+    goto factorial(n,1,n,print,__return,__environment);
+}
+
+__code print(int n,int result,int orig,__code(*print)(),__code (*exit1)(),void*exit1env)
+{
+    printf("#0032:%d! = %d\n",orig, result);
+    goto (*exit1)(0,exit1env);
+}
+
